Jdbc api tutorial and reference pdf apa

He is the author of database programming with jdbc and java, 2nd edition and the worlds first jdbc driver, the msql jdbc driver for msql. This new edition has been updated and expanded to cover the entire jdbc 3. Because data types in sql and data types in the java programming language are not identical, there needs to be some. Jdbc stands for j ava d ata b ase c onnectivity, which is a standard java api for databaseindependent connectivity between the java programming language and a wide range of databases. Jdbc 2 3 jdbc jdbc introduction jdbc provides a standard library for accessing relational databases api standardizes way to establish connection to database approach to initiating queries. For reference, jdbc is a standard api that allows access to a database through sql language in a database independant way. A jdbc driver implements a lot of the jdbc interfaces. Combines a stepbystep tutorial with a comprehensive reference to all of the classes and interface, and gives indepth explanations that.

This book provides the definitive tutorial and reference to the jdbc api, the technology that enables universal data access for the java programming language. Apache phoenix takes your sql query, compiles it into a series of hbase scans, and orchestrates the running of those scans to produce regular jdbc result sets. This module deals with enhanced support for jpa based data access layers. Oracle database jdbc developers guide and reference. This tutorial on jdbc explains you the concept to java database connectivity with the help of articles. This bibliography was generated on cite this for me on sunday, may 5, 2019. Java database connectivity jdbc tutorial this tutorial on jdbc explains you the concept to java database connectivity with the help of articles, examples and code examples. Oracle database jdbc developers guide and reference 10g release 2 10. Jdbc api tutorial and reference, 3e is a stepbystep tutorial on the jdbc also includes an exhaustive reference section for all the jdbc api methods, classes. Jdbc driver api reference sql server microsoft docs. A typed query gives applications more control over return types. W3school htmlcss tutorials, references and examples.

If you already know sql, the jdbc api tutorial and reference, second edition. What is jdbc api in jdbc tutorial 02 may 2020 learn what. As a developer you write your repository interfaces, including custom finder methods, and spring will provide the implementation automatically. For java programmers jdbc basics, java online tutorial. Jdbc api tutorial and reference free pdf, djvu, fb2, fb3.

Donald bales jdbc the java database connectivity specificationis a complex set of application programming interfaces apis that developers need to understand if they want their java applications to work with. Donald bales jdbcthe java database connectivity specificationis a complex set of application programming interfaces apis that developers need to understand if they want their java applications to work with. Jdbc is portable since java is portable across platforms. Table of contents indexjdbc api tutorial and reference, third edition by maydene fisher, jon ellis, jonathan bru. White and others published jdbc api tutorial and reference find, read and cite all the research you need on researchgate.

Convention explanation italics introduces new terms that you may not be familiar. Java database connectivity jdbc is an application programming interface api for the programming language java, which defines how a client may access a. Java database connectivity jdbc is the javasoft specification of a standard application programming interface api that allows java programs to access database management systems. Table of contents index jdbc api tutorial and reference, third edition by maydene fisher, jon ellis, jonathan bru. These are the sources and citations used to research java prerequisite project. Jdbc api tutorial and reference 3rd ed pdf free download epdf. Jdbc api tutorial and reference, 3rd edition informit. Actually, there are four tutorials in the part one. For some functionalities you need to include also the jdbc optional package import javax. This tutorial explains how to use the java persistence api. Seth white is the author of jdbc api tutorial and reference 3. Introduction to jdbc core java tutorial studytonight. Universal data access for the javatm 2 platform 2nd edition download free epub, pdf this book provides the definitive description of the jdbcaa a api, the technology that enables universal data access for the javaaa a programming language.

This book provides the definitive tutorial and reference to the jdbc tm api, the technology that enables universal data access for the javatm programming language. What is jdbc api in jdbc tutorial 02 may 2020 learn what is. Using jdbc you can send sql, plsql statements to almost any relational database. The jdbc api consists of a set of interfaces and classes written in the java programming language. The ibm t ivoli netcoolomnibus gateway for jdbc uses the standar d java database connectivity jdbc api to exchange alerts between netcoolomnibus objectservers and external databases. In the jdbc tutorial we will learn jdbc in detail with the help of example code. The jdbc api is part of the java platform, it includes the java standard edition. This section provides reference information about derby s implementation of the jdbc api and documents the way it conforms to the jdbc 2. Spring data jpa aims to significantly improve the implementation of data access layers by reducing the effort to the amount thats actually needed. It offers the main classes for interacting with your data sources. Jdbc is used to interact with various type of database such as oracle, ms access, my sql and sql server.

Maydene fisher author of jdbc api tutorial and reference. Universal data access for the java 2 platform book is probably the best of the bunch. In addition to providing connectivity to a wide range of sql databases, jdbc allows you to access other tabular data sources such as spreadsheets or flat files. What is jdbc api in jdbc what is jdbc api in jdbc courses with reference manuals and examples pdf. All content included on our site, such as text, images, digital downloads and other, is the property of its content suppliers and protected by us and international laws. If the types arent compatible, an exception will be thrown. Jdbc components learn java online beginners tutorial for. The material in this chapter is based on jdbctm api tutorial and reference, second edition. It uses eclipselink, the reference implementation for the java persistence api jpa. Java tutorial what is jdbc java database connectivity api.

Jdbc api tutorial and reference, 3e is a stepbystep tutorial on the jdbc also includes an exhaustive reference section for all the jdbc api methods, classes and interfaces. This is the latest jdbc version at the time of writing this tutorial. Jdbc api to use the jdbc api is necessary to include in your file the command import java. The microsoft jdbc driver for sql server provides an api that can be used within java programming code to connect to and interact with a microsoftsql server database. This package include classes and interface to perform almost all jdbc operation such as creating and executing sql queries. Free pdf download getting started with the jdbc api. What is jdbc jdbc, often known as java database connectivity, provides a java api for updating and querying relational databases using structured query language sql jdbc is now at version 2. The jdbc library includes apis for each of the tasks mentioned below that are commonly associated with database usage. David sawyer mcfarland, css 3 the missing manual, 3rd ed, 20, oreilly. Spring data jpa, part of the larger spring data family, makes it easy to easily implement jpa based repositories. Universal data access for the javatm 2 platform, published by addison wesley as part of the java series, isbn 0201433281 8. He is the author of database programming with jdbc and java, 2nd edition and the worlds first jdbc driver, the msqljdbc driver for msql.

Api tutorial and reference 3rd edition fisher, maydene, ellis, jon, bruce, jonathan on. The jdbc api gives access of programming data from the java. Create your citations, reference lists and bibliographies automatically using the apa, mla, chicago, or harvard referencing styles. Java database connectivity theory tutorial duration. If no base package is configured, it uses the package in which the configuration class resides. This book provides the definitive tutorial and reference to the jdbc api, the technology that enables universal data access for the java. Java database connectivityjdbc is an application programming interface api used to connect java application with database.

Jdbctoodbc bridge, in both type 1 and type 3 forms, has been. George has since specialized in the development of internetoriented java enterprise systems and the strategic role of technology in business processes. Seth white author of jdbc api tutorial and reference. The jdbcodbc bridge odbc open database connectivity is a microsoft standard from the mid 1990s. Jun 22, 2014 if you already know sql, the jdbc api tutorial and reference, second edition. The jdbc api is the application programming interface that provides universal data access for the java programming language. This chapter provides reference information about derbys implementation of the jdbc api and documents the way it. Datadirect connect for jdbc users guide and reference typographical conventions this book uses the following typographical conventions.

Spring and spring boot web applications and api developer. Oracle database jdbc developers guide and reference 10g release 1 10. Database access with jdbc originals of slides and source code for examples. Jdbc api tutorial and reference by maydene fisher in djvu, fb2, fb3 download ebook. To create a connection, you need to load the driver first. Simple tutorial for using jdbc the jdbc java database connectivity api defines interfaces and classes for writing database applications in java by making database connections. Jdbc also allow us to access an odbcbased database using a jdbcodbc bridge. Provides a definitive description of the jdbc api, the technology that enables universal data access for the java programming language. The key classes in the api are driver manager, connection, statement, results set and data source. Combines a stepbystep tutorial with a comprehensive reference to all of the classes and interface, and gives indepth explanations that go beyond the specification. Java persistence api jpa mapping java objects to database tables and vice versa is called objectrelational mapping orm.

Jdbc is a java database connectivity api that lets you access virtually any tabular data source from a java application. Mar 30, 2014 the jdbc api is defined in two packages. B1097901 december 2003 this book describes how to use the oracle jdbc drivers to develop powerful java database applications. This new jdbc api moves java applications into the world of heavyduty.

It makes it easier to build springpowered applications that use data access technologies. The driver class to load obviously depends on the jdbc driver and thus on the database that needs to be on the classpath. Comdb2 extensions to the jdbc api executing typed queries. Introduction to jdbc based on slides by tony printezis dept of computing science university of glasgow 17 lilybank gardens introduction to jdbc p. Oct 12, 2015 this book provides the definitive tutorial and reference to the jdbc api, the technology that enables universal data access for the java programming language. This chapter provides reference information about derbys implementation of the jdbc api and documents the way it conforms to the jdbc 2. The book also includes a tutorial on the new rowset implementations, including the webrowset implementation rowsets make it easy to send tabular data over a network. Database programming with jdbc and java george reese. How to make database connectivity in java using jdbc api. Jdbc can also be defined as the platformindependent interface between a relational database and java programming. The flexibility of the api allows for a broad range of implementations.

Its primary purpose is to intimately tie connectivity to databases with the java language. Most people believe that jdbc stands for java data base connectivity but not quiteit used to be, but now is a trademarked name excerpt. Jdbc api jdbc is an interface which allows java code to execute sql statements inside relational databases java program connectivity. Jdbc api jdbc driver api vendor specific jdbc driver vendor specific odbc driver jdbcodbc bridge database jdbc data types 10 jdbc type java type. Cdb2jdbc is a jdbc type 4 driver, which means that the driver is a platformindependent, pure java implementation. Jdbc stands for java database connectivity it is a standard java api for databaseindependent connectivity between the java programming language and databases. The driver is a native protocol alljava driver type number four of types defined by sun. Jdbc is a java api for executing sql statements and. After completing this tutorial you will get the skills to use jdbc api effectively to develop database driven applications in java. To use this, applications can execute sql statements and retrieve results and updation to the database. The database will coerce the types of the resulting columns to the types specified by the application.

Book excerpt index chapter 3 advanced tutorial note. Well discuss the reasoning behind the jdbc in this chapter, as well as the design of the jdbc and its associated api. Implementing a data access layer of an application has been. Jdbc also allow us to access an odbcbased database using a jdbc odbc bridge. It communicates with the supported databases using java t ype 4 jdbc drivers supplied by the database vendors. Mapping computer science department of computer science. Reference database and enterprise web application development in j2ee. Comdb2 provides java programming language binding with cdb2jdbc. A jdbc driver is a collection of java classes that enables you to connect to a certain database. The jdbctm api provides universal data access from the javatm programming language. That makes the jdbc api the only api for working with derby databases. Maydene fisher is the author of jdbc api tutorial and reference 3. Jdbc 2 3 jdbc jdbc introduction jdbc provides a standard library for accessing relational databases api standardizes way to establish connection to database. Jdbc can also be defined as the platformindependent interface between a relational database.

The configuration class in the preceding example sets up an embedded hsql database by using the embeddeddatabasebuilder api of springjdbc. Jdbc api, a purely javabased api jdbc driver manager,which communicates with vendorspecific drivers that perform the real communication. When your code uses a given jdbc driver, it actually just uses the standard jdbc interfaces. Jdbc api is a java api that can access a relational database. It provides classes and interface to access serverside data. Since its introduction in january 1997, the jdbc api has become widely accepted and implemented. Jdbc provides the same capabilities as odbc, allowing java programs to contain databaseindependent code. As a point of interest, jdbc is a trademarked name and is not an.

252 1083 503 1283 1193 79 785 1296 1503 1596 855 1492 1008 1322 1125 1187 250 703 1264 171 891 907 355 479 1365 942 786 774 1064 162 373 1123 1391 848 586 482 227 213 349 746 2 775 242 213 981 602 1136 486 710